Claims
- 1. The method of increasing feed intake in an immature ruminant animal subject comprising administering orally or by implant to said animal subject a quantity effective for increasing feed intake but nontoxic to the subject of a tertiary alcohol having the formula:
- RR'R"CX
- in which:
- R is lower alkyl of from 1-9 carbons or hydroxy lower alkyl of from 1-9 carbons;
- R' is lower alkyl of from 1-9 carbons, fluoro, bromo or chloro;
- R" is lower alkyl of from 1-9 carbons, lower alkenyl of from 2-9 carbons.Iadd., lower alkynyl of from 2-9 carbons .Iaddend.and, when R and R' are lower alkyl or hydrogen, .Iadd.R" is .Iaddend.phenyl; and
- X is --OH.
- 2. The method of claim 1 in which R, R' and R" are lower alkyl of from 1-5 carbons.
- 3. The method of claim 1 in which the animal is sheep or cattle.
- 4. The method of claim 2 in which the subject animal is sheep or cattle.
- 5. The method of claim 1 in which the internal administration is orally and admixed with the animal feed.
- 6. The method of claim 5 in which the quantity of tertiary alcohol derivative is from about 10 g.-2 kg. per ton of feed.
- 7. The method of claim 5 in which the quantity of tertiary alcohol derivative is about 50 mg.-10 g. per animal subject.
- 8. A ruminant animal feed composition comprising an animal feed carrier supplemented by a quantity of active ingredient effective for increasing feed intake but nontoxic to the animal, said active ingredient being a tertiary alcohol derivative of the formula:
- RR'R"CX
- in which:
- R is lower alkyl of from 1-9 carbons or hydroxy lower alkyl of from 1-9 carbons;
- R' is lower alkyl of from 1-9 carbons, fluoro, bromo or chloro;
- R" is lower alkyl of from 1-9 carbons, lower alkenyl of from 2-9 carbons.Iadd., lower alkynyl of from 2-9 carbons .Iaddend.and, when R and R' are lower alkyl or hydrogen R" is phenyl; and
- X is --OH.
- 9. The feed composition of claim 8 in which the said active ingredient is a tertiary alcohol of the formula:
- RR'R"COH
- in which R, R' and R" are lower alkyl of 1-5 carbons.
- 10. The feed composition of claim 1 in which the said composition is a whole feed adapted for fattening immature ruminant animals.
- 11. The feed composition of claim 8 in which the said composition is a premix composition adapted for mixing uniformly throughout a whole animal feed adapted for fattening immature ruminant animals.
- 12. The feed composition of claim 10 in which the active ingredient is present within the range of from about 100 g. to 2 kg. per ton of feed.
- 13. The feed composition of claim 11 in which the active ingredient is present at the rate of about 1-75 percent by weight.
- 14. The feed composition of claim 9 in which the active ingredient is present within the range of from about 100 g. to 2 kg. per ton of feed.
